帝国cms防止图片木马上传
时间 : 2023-12-08 05:11: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
最佳答案
帝国CMS是一种常用的内容管理系统,用于建设和维护网站。在网站中,图片是不可或缺的元素,但同时也存在着一些安全隐患,例如图片木马的上传。
图片木马是一种恶意软件,它会利用上传的图片文件来传播病毒或获取用户信息。为了防止图片木马的上传,我们可以采取以下措施:
1. 文件类型限制:通过设置文件上传的扩展名限制,只允许上传常见的图片格式,如JPEG、PNG等,而限制其他可执行文件的上传。这样就能阻止木马文件的上传。
2. 文件大小限制:通过限制文件上传的最大大小,可以减少恶意上传大型木马文件的机会。可以根据网站的实际需求,将文件大小限制设置为合理的范围。
3. 图片信息验证:在上传图片之前,对文件进行检查和验证。可以使用图像处理库来读取图片的元数据,检查是否包含恶意代码或隐藏文件。如果发现异常,可以阻止其上传,并给予相应的错误提示。
4. 安全扫描:使用专业的安全检测工具对上传的图片进行扫描,检测是否存在恶意代码或病毒。这些工具能够识别和隔离潜在的威胁,帮助保障站点的安全。
5. 权限控制:限制网站上传图片的权限,只允许已验证的用户或管理员上传图片。这样可以降低恶意用户上传木马的风险。
6. 定期更新:及时更新CMS系统和相关插件,以获取最新的安全补丁和漏洞修复。这样可以减少黑客利用已知漏洞上传木马的机会。
7. 定期备份:定期备份网站数据和图片文件,以便在出现问题时进行恢复。备份数据是保障网站安全的重要措施之一。
总的来说,防止图片木马上传需要综合运用文件类型限制、文件大小限制、图片信息验证、安全扫描、权限控制、定期更新和定期备份等多种手段。同时,也需要持续关注和学习最新的网络安全技术,以确保网站的安全性和稳定性。
其他答案
帝国CMS是一种非常受欢迎的内容管理系统,但是由于其开放性和灵活性,也容易成为黑客进行攻击的目标之一。其中一个常见的攻击方式就是通过上传包含恶意代码的图片文件来植入木马程序。为了防止这种情况发生,我们可以采取一些安全措施来保护我们的网站。
首先,我们应该限制图片上传的文件类型。只允许上传常见的图片格式,如JPEG、PNG、GIF等,而禁止上传可执行文件和其他危险文件类型。这可以通过在后台设置中进行配置来实现。
其次,我们可以对上传的图片进行检测和过滤。可以通过使用杀毒软件或者安全插件来扫描上传的图片文件,以确保其中没有恶意代码。同时,我们还可以使用图片处理库或者函数对上传的图片进行处理,去除其中的隐藏代码或者可疑信息。
此外,还需要加强对文件权限的控制。在服务器上,我们应该设置适当的文件权限,以确保只有有限的用户可以对上传的图片进行修改或执行操作。同时,我们还可以使用独立的图片目录,并设置目录的访问权限,以限制只有授权用户能够对其中的图片进行访问和操作。
另外,定期更新和升级帝国CMS也是非常重要的一点。每个版本的CMS都会修复一些已知的安全漏洞,因此,及时更新和升级可以极大地减少被攻击的风险。
最后,我们还可以通过增加网络安全防护设备来提升网站的安全性。例如,配置防火墙、Web应用程序防火墙(WAF)等设备,可以帮助我们实时监测和拦截恶意请求,有效地防止木马图片的上传。
综上所述,通过限制文件类型、检测过滤图片、加强文件权限控制、及时更新和升级CMS,并增加网络安全防护设备,我们可以有效地防止帝国CMS中图片木马的上传和攻击,保护网站和用户的安全。
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章